What were the average and median salaries for a Councillor listed in the 2024 Ontario Government Sunshine List?

The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List shows that the average and median salaries for a Councillor are $122,509.00 and $120,285.98, respectively.

What is the highest salary for a Councillor in a public organization in Ontario?

In 2024, Linda Jackson-campese, holding the position of Regional Councillor at the City of Vaughan received the highest salary of $177,403.98 among similar positions in Ontario public organizations. Paul Ainslie, serving as the Councillor at City of Toronto , earned the highest salary of $134,532.44 among individuals in the same position across public organizations in Ontario during that year.

What are the top 5 public organizations in Ontario that offer the highest salaries for Councillor?

In the year 2024, the highest-paying organizations for Councillor and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: City of Richmond Hill with an average pay of $156,670.08; Town of Newmarket with an average pay of $148,146.69; Town of Whitby with an average pay of $134,642.83; City of Vaughan with an average pay of $132,625.10; and Municipality of Clarington with an average pay of $129,857.92.

A total of 17 organizations had employees who held comparable positions as mentioned in the Ontario Sunshine list.

What are the top 3 public sectors in Ontario that offer the highest salaries for Councillor?

In the year 2024, the highest-paying sector or industries for Councillor and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Municipalities and Services with an average pay of $122,623.33; and Government of Ontario - Ministries with an average pay of $106,503.04.

There were 2 sectors where employees held similar positions, as indicated in the Ontario Sunshine list.

What is the representation of gender diversity for Councillor in Ontario?

The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List indicates that the representation of gender diversity in Councillor is 63.55% male and 36.45% female, respectively.
